Hooker chosen to assist Socceroos boss
Michael Cockerill
October 4, 2010 - 5:10PM
Robbie Hooker famously cried when he missed out on going to the World Cup as a player, but the former international will be hoping to make up for it as a coach after being appointed as an assistant to new Socceroos boss Holger Osieck.
Hooker, 43, will join former Socceroos teammate Aurelio Vidmar on the national team staff, and is expected to start work today when the squad assembles in Sydney before Saturday night's friendly international against Paraguay.
Capped 20 times by Australia, Hooker was inconsolable in the MCG dressing room after the Socceroos lost out in the infamous play-off against Iran in 1997 in what proved to be the end of his own international career.
Since retiring as a player, Hooker has worked as an assistant to the national women's team, the Matildas, and now gets the biggest opportunity of his coaching career after impressing Osieck during a coaching course in Sydney last year, when the German was here as a FIFA instructor.
One of the conditions of Osieck's appointment was that he appoint two Australian assistants, and Hooker has beaten a strong list of candidates headed by former Newcastle Jets coach Gary van Egmond, now working at the AIS.
